Compare the lifestyles of hunter-gatherers with those of settlers of early agricultural communities. The Neolithic Revolution
a. led people to lead lives based on hunting and gathering
b. allowed people to live in permanent settlements
c. reduced people’s need for food and resources
d. prevented the advance of civilization

Answers

Answer:

B. Allowed people to live in permanent settlements.

Explanation:

Before the Neolithic Revolution, humans were hunter-gatherers, therefore they were nomadic and had to move around so that they could find food. Once people started settling in agricultural communities, they were able to grow their food and keep animals that could also be used for food/tools. They  no longer needed to move around and they were able to settle in a permanent spot.

Because of an unfavorable political situation between the countries, the United Stats has placed a government order to prohibit the trade of cigars with Cuba. The USA has maintained a(n) _____ with Cuba.

Group of answer choices

trade tariff

trade embargo

quota limit

fixed tariff

ad valorem tariff

Answers

The USA has maintained a trade embargo with Cuba. So, option b is correct.

A trade embargo, also known as a trade blockade, is a type of trade barrier in which one country or a group of countries prohibits trade with another country. Trade embargoes can be implemented for a variety of reasons, including political, economic, or military motivations. A country will typically enforce a trade embargo in order to punish another country for some perceived wrongdoing. So, option b is correct.

A trade embargo refers to a government-imposed restriction or prohibition on the trade of certain goods or services with a particular country or countries. It is a political and economic tool used by governments to exert pressure or influence on other nations, typically as a response to specific policies, actions, or conflicts.

why you feel this peace that was achieved by the Pax Mongolica was based off of fear or a true belief in the Mongol Empire. In other words, was the loyalty that the Mongols felt a result of true love for the empire or fear of death.

Answers

The correct answer to this open question is the following.

I feel this peace that was achieved by the Pax Mongolica was first based on fear and later turned to be a true belief in the Mongol Empire. This means that at first, people feared the Mongols for all the terrible reputation they had gained through the years for their violent attacks and invasions. Then people expressed their loyalty to the Mongols not really as a result of true love, but probably respect. because with Mongol's character, the fear of death or punishment always was present.

The Pax Mongolica was a time of relative peace in the region when people felt more confident to establish commerce again, started to travel again and trade with other nations. It was a time from the 13th to the 14th century in which that region lived in times of peace and certain economic and political stability.

The Japanese air force attacks the US army base at Pearl Harbor.

Answers

Answer: Pearl Harbor attack, (December 7, 1941), surprise aerial attack on the U.S. naval base at Pearl Harbor on Oahu Island, Hawaii, by the Japanese that precipitated the entry of the United States into World War II. The strike climaxed a decade of worsening relations between the United States and Japan.

In the context above statement, evaluate the impact of pseudoscientific ldeas of race on the Jewish nation by the Nazi Germany during the period 1933 to 1946 (Background) ​

Answers

Answer: During the period of 1933 to 1945, Nazi Germany, led by Adolf Hitler, implemented a systematic genocide of the Jewish people, known as the Holocaust. The ideology behind this genocide was rooted in the pseudoscientific ideas of race, which were used to justify the persecution and extermination of the Jewish people.

The Nazi regime viewed Jews as a separate and inferior race and used these pseudoscientific ideas to promote the notion of a "master race" of Aryans. They believed that Jews were responsible for many of the world's problems and were a threat to the purity of the Aryan race. These ideas were propagated through propaganda, including posters, speeches, and publications, which promoted anti-Semitic beliefs and attitudes.

As a result of these pseudoscientific ideas, the Jewish people were subjected to discrimination, persecution, and ultimately, genocide. Beginning in 1933, Jews were stripped of their rights and freedoms, including their citizenship, and were forced to wear identifying marks such as the yellow Star of David. They were subjected to pogroms, forced labor, and mass deportations to concentration and extermination camps, where millions of Jews were murdered.

The impact of these pseudoscientific ideas on the Jewish nation was devastating. The Holocaust resulted in the deaths of six million Jews, representing approximately two-thirds of the Jewish population of Europe at that time. The Jewish people were traumatized and displaced, and many survivors were left with physical and emotional scars that lasted a lifetime.

Furthermore, the Holocaust had a profound impact on the Jewish community worldwide, leading to a renewed commitment to Jewish identity and a sense of collective responsibility for the Jewish people. The establishment of the State of Israel in 1948 was a direct response to the Holocaust and the need for a homeland for the Jewish people.

In conclusion, the pseudoscientific ideas of race that were propagated by Nazi Germany during the period of 1933 to 1945 had a devastating impact on the Jewish nation. The Holocaust resulted in the deaths of millions of Jews and had a profound impact on the Jewish community worldwide. It serves as a reminder of the dangers of pseudoscientific ideas and the importance of combating hate and discrimination.

brainly the persians were the first civilization to create what

Answers

The Persians were the first civilization to create the postal service.

The royal road was established by the Persians, and it was used to send messages quickly. This was the first step in establishing a postal system. The invention of the first system of communication occurred during the ancient Persian Empire, where Darius the Great created the Royal Road to connect the Persian Empire.

This ancient system of communication is an important step in the development of postal systems because the Royal Road was used to deliver messages over long distances quickly and effectively.
